We were in a pinch and needed to replace our last dishwasher immediately. We wash 2-4 full loads per day so replacement had to be done quickly. We looked at several and decided on this one, mostly because I wanted the hidden heating element and this does have that.
After using this thing many times per day, over several months, I have to say I regret buying it. It doesn't get the dishes clean, no matter how light it's loaded, nor what products are used. (We use Cascade rinse aid and detergent "pods" - usually the Platinum ones). If you don't completely pre-wash the dishes, they come out with food residue still on them. For a product that advertises it has "Hard Food Disposer – Washes Away Heavy Foods With Ease, No Need to Pre-Rinse", I have to say that's not been true with our unit. Granted, we have a well, so not the best water pressure from the tap, however the previous two dishwashers never had this problem so I find it hard to believe it's a water pressure issue.
Most of our "food residue" is from chopped fruits and vegetables, breads, or baked grain casseroles (similar to a rice pilaf)- not anything baked or caked on. Just food that was served in a bowl and the bowls are shaken out over the trash can before we wash them off by hand then load into this dishwasher. We aren't washing many pots and pans. It's mostly just the small plastic bowls we use to feed the over 100 birds we care for every day. I doubt the "hard food disposer" in this unit has ever actually seen any "hard food".
The lack of options is also a big drawback. No "Pre-Rinse", "Rinse and hold" or "Rinse" option like other dishwashers I have owned. The cycles are LONG. The "Quick" cycle takes about an hour. And speaking of cycles - the unit DOES NOT restart when you close the door. If you open the door to add a dish after it has been started, you have to manually re-start the cycle by pushing the "Start" button. If you happen to forget to re-hit that button, (and the only clue is the "wash-rinse-dry-end" lights are off) then your dirty dishes will still be there to greet you, smelling like a high school gym locker room, when you open the door expecting to see sparkling, clean dishes. And if you accidently hit the POWER instead of start? It drains all the water out from the current cycle, then starts from the beginning.
Do you want to raise or lower the top rack to accommodate tall or bulky dishes? Do it before loading the rack, as you have to pull the entire rack out and insert it between a different set of rollers to change position.
The rack design doesn't hold near as many dishes as our previous two dishwashers. They seem like they were just not very well designed. I do like the fact that the silverware basket is actually 2 small ones. Makes it easier to store when not in use.
The unit is very quiet. There is that.
Pros: quiet
Cons: Poor quality, doesn't clean well, no "rinse" only option, adjusting rack height involves removing it
